Output 1cccfaf25be03d17cbbb0a60c871ce0676eed518ac3c8f140e80a53033b2a2aa:0

value
11347214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da6f1a5f45ed7982d99497edcc35675cae79661 OP_EQUAL
address
3Mu1FQXeC3NEn6XcuDwXF5uEVUa9P3tz1F
transaction
1cccfaf25be03d17cbbb0a60c871ce0676eed518ac3c8f140e80a53033b2a2aa
confirmations
48521
spent
true